CG55 AJG is a 2009 BMW 120 in Black with a 1,995c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 93.8%.
Across all 2009 BMW 120 models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.5% with a typical mileage of 75,835 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a BMW 120 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 22,169 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CG55 AJG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 120 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 17 years old, this BMW 120 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
